Another option is to move away from the screens and focus more on the real world.

This is reflected in a study prepared by Monitoring Future, that through a longitudinal survey has been measuring the impact of the expansion of new technologies in the new generations. An investigation that showed how in the 90s the level of self-esteem in the youngest grew until 2012, when they experienced a drastic decline.


Arrival of the smpartphones

What happened so that from 2012 Will this drop in young people's self-esteem be observed? The researchers highlight that in this year 50% of Americans, the country in which this study was conducted, already had a smartphone. Something that made new generations develop other types of activities such as spending time on social networks, text messaging or gaming applications.

The increase in these activities led to the decline of other practices such as sports, physical interpersonal interaction, performance of duties or participation in activities within their community. The results of the study showed that the group of adolescents with the highest level of unhappiness was the one who consumed more than twenty hours of screens a week.


On the other hand, the group that showed the greatest personal satisfaction was that they had a physical interaction above the average and a use of social networks below the average. The authors of this study indicate that these results do not mean that there is a direct cause-effect nexus between happiness and the use of new technologies, but a correlation that should be taken into account by families when organizing the leisure activities of their children.

Benefits of outdoor activities

This study once again highlights the advantages of the activities fresh air instead of betting on a more sedentary lifestyle. The following benefits are indicated from the National Center for Physical Development:

- It makes children get fit, which makes them prevent health problems arising from overweight and sedentary lifestyle.


- Your immune system is favored by exposure to external agents, which helps the development of antibodies that will help prevent diseases.

- They know the world around them, which helps them to improve their vocabulary (they learn to name new objects) and their culture.

- Reduces stress levels. Being out of the four walls, anxiety is lowered. An open and green environment always helps to reduce these tensions.
